Expansion of Digital Channels

In a world increasingly reliant on technology, McDonald's is doubling down on its digital capabilities. This includes enhancements to its mobile app and online ordering systems, allowing for a more convenient customer experience. Recent reports indicate that a significant portion of sales now comes from digital channels, underscoring the importance of staying relevant in a digital-first marketplace.

Long-Term Investment Strategies

McDonald's commitment to long-term growth is evident in its investments in sustainability and community engagement. By focusing on these areas, the company aims to build a robust brand reputation while also appealing to ethically-minded consumers.

Sustainability Initiatives

  • Reducing greenhouse gas emissions across global operations.
  • Enhancing supply chain sustainability through responsible sourcing.
  • Investing in renewable energy solutions for restaurant operations.

Community Engagement

Engaging with local communities is crucial for McDonald's long-term strategy. The company has launched various programs aimed at supporting local economies and addressing social issues, which resonate well with today's consumers who value social responsibility.
